Publisher's Summary

A HIT NETFLIX FILM, WINNER OF 7 BAFTAS AND NOMINATED FOR 9 OSCARS

The most famous anti-war novel ever written.

One by one the boys begin to fall...

In 1914 a room full of German schoolboys, fresh-faced and idealistic, are goaded by their schoolmaster to troop off to the 'glorious war'. With the fire and patriotism of youth they sign up. What follows is the moving story of a young 'unknown soldier' experiencing the horror and disillusionment of life in the trenches.

amazing telling of a beautifully chilling story

It's the same formula to many war stories, a kid headed off to war too young and slowly numbed by the horrors of the front, but somehow this is still so enthralling. It's the earnest voice and the internal battle of the protagonist, half depreciating the infectious camaraderie of war, the other half questioning why they would ever happen.

Amazing Story, If a Bit Rushed Narration-Wise

The story in itself is one to be absorbed and digested. However the narration seemed a bit blasé. Had the narrator took more time to slow down and reach and become Paul in the book, it would have been more engaging.
